У нас постоянно меняющаяся инфраструктура (капли DigitalOcean и экземпляры AWS EC2, которые создаются и удаляются). Мы используем Ansible для начальной загрузки виртуальных машин и установки сетевых данных на каждую виртуальную машину. Цель состоит в том, чтобы получать электронные письма с каждого компьютера с from
поле быть alerts@our-domain.com
. Мы используем G Suite для обработки всех писем (мы настроили все MX
записи и рекомендуется базовый G Suite SPF
/TXT
запись).
Смотря на Инструкции Google Я нашел это:
Использование ретрансляции SMTP неприемлемо, поскольку нам нужно было занести в белый список все IP-адреса для новых виртуальных машин и удалить IP-адреса удаленных виртуальных машин.
Использование SMTP-сервера Gmail неприемлемо, поскольку нам нужно было иметь выделенную учетную запись (и платить за нее) для входа в систему.
При использовании SMTP-сервера Gmail с ограниченным доступом может возникнуть проблема с ограничением, сообщения отмечен от G Suite Spam Filter, и если мы хотим внести виртуальные машины в белый список, мы попадаем в смесь проблем по причине 1 и причине 2.
Итак, мой вопрос: каковы лучшие практики для такого рода предупреждений по электронной почте? Ребята, вы добавляете IP-адреса вручную в фильтры G Suite? Вы, ребята, платите за дополнительный аккаунт G Suite?
заранее спасибо